Bleeding diarrhea is a condition where blood is present in the stool, accompanied by diarrhea. This symptom can be alarming and is often indicative of underlying gastrointestinal issues. The presence of blood in diarrhea can vary from streaks of red blood on the surface of the stool to dark, tarry stools, which indicate bleeding from the upper gastrointestinal tract. Common causes include gastrointestinal infections, such as bacterial infections (e.g., Salmonella, Shigella, or Campylobacter) and parasitic infections, which can cause inflammation and damage to the intestinal lining. Inflammatory bowel diseases (IBD) like Crohn's disease and ulcerative colitis are also significant causes, characterized by chronic inflammation and ulceration of the gastrointestinal tract. Other causes include hemorrhoids or anal fissures, which can cause bleeding in the lower part of the digestive system, and more severe conditions such as colorectal cancer, which may present with bleeding and changes in bowel habits.
Treatment for bleeding diarrhea depends on the underlying cause and severity of the symptoms. For infections, appropriate antibiotics or antiparasitic medications are prescribed to address the specific pathogen. Managing IBD typically involves medications such as corticosteroids, immunosuppressants, or biologics to reduce inflammation and control symptoms. Hemorrhoids and anal fissures may be treated with topical medications, dietary changes to reduce constipation, and in some cases, surgical interventions. For severe cases or when bleeding is significant or persistent, further diagnostic testing such as endoscopy, colonoscopy, or imaging may be required to identify the cause and guide treatment. Ensuring adequate hydration, avoiding irritant foods, and following a healthcare provider's recommendations are crucial for managing symptoms and supporting recovery. If bleeding diarrhea occurs, consulting a healthcare provider is essential for a thorough evaluation and appropriate treatment.
